nice flower composition.
Congrats with your new camera.
Pity good lenses are very very expensive.
I was at first very very disapointed with my 300D.
18-55 lens isnt that good.and all affordable Canon lenses are plastic.
50mm 1.8II lens is better,if you can focus it right.
The focus point is extremely narrow.
I started using old second hand Russian Manual lenses with good satisfaction.
They fit Canon with M42 adapter ring.
Can't get any sharp images out of canon software.
I am using Windows and maybe the software is better on Mac.
I am shooting RAW images only and using Capture One Le from Phase one Software giving me a good colour balance and sharp images too.
